C5 Feelings Would also Have Inertia!

Yeh Xirann hadn't anticipated meeting Mu Yanchen so effortlessly. She had initially intended for her assistant, Kuan Yue, to deliver the divorce and transfer agreements on her behalf.

Signing them today would be an unexpected bonus.

Mu Yanchen's icy gaze quickly scanned the documents, his aura growing even colder.

Yeh Xirann braced herself for his typically biting remarks, the kind that used to pierce her heart...

But unexpectedly, his expression softened. He turned to Mu Wenxuan and said, "I'll have the driver take you home. You've been at this for hours; you deserve some rest. Make sure to take a nap after lunch."

"But we haven't finished choosing the theme for the maternity shoot..." Mu Wenxuan's voice was tinged with a plea as she pouted, "This might be my only pregnancy. I want to capture it perfectly, without any regrets. Will you stay and help me finish? It won't take long..."

After a moment's contemplation, Mu Yanchen instructed Yeh Xirann, "Go wait at Kuan Yue's desk. We'll call you once we're through."

In the past, Yeh Xirann would have defiantly argued her case, even knowing she'd be met with harsh criticism.

But now...

She picked up her belongings and walked away without a backward glance, her face devoid of emotion.

Seated in Kuan Yue's office chair, she pressed a hand to her chest, taking deep breaths until she felt somewhat at ease.

It seems emotions have their own inertia...

Despite having made a firm decision, witnessing Mu Yanchen's tenderness towards Mu Wenxuan still stirred her heart.

She had never been on the receiving end of such kindness.

Mu Yanchen always fobbed her off with excuses about overtime and meetings, rarely taking her calls—nine times out of ten, it was Kuan Yue who picked up.

She, too, had once selected a maternity photoshoot with the hope of cherishing her first pregnancy.

Regrettably, from choosing the location to the final photo selection, it was Kuan Yue who accompanied her by order, while Mu Yanchen never once showed up...

After the incident, it seems the photoshoot was forgotten for so long that the shop owner disposed of it.

In a fleeting moment, Yeh Xirann found herself pondering the past decade—her unwavering love and devotion to him. What had she truly received in return?

A marriage that existed in name only, blatant exploitation, and a destruction that ravaged her from body to soul.

During the six months she struggled on the brink of life and death, her so-called husband, the man on their marriage certificate, hadn't lifted a finger to help. Instead, he relentlessly stripped her of her family's business.

Had it not been for her brother selling his blood to cover her hospital and treatment bills, she would have been reduced to nothing but ashes!

And the child she had been coerced into conceiving to appease the Mu family—since Mu Yanchen found a better option, the child was left to a fate of utter disregard, likely discarded like medical waste.

Her own child... she never even had the chance to see them...

Reflecting on it now, Yeh Xirann couldn't believe how foolish she had been.

Kuan Yue's desk was cluttered with various items. As she regained her composure, she casually picked up a magazine to while away the time.

Fashion industry fluff never really caught her interest.

A note slipped out as she aimlessly flipped through the pages. It contained pairs of words, each written with a strong, neat calligraphy. One pair was heavily underscored with several lines.

"Linhui..." The name brought Yeh Xirann to the verge of tears as she uttered it.

It was unmistakably Mu Yanchen's handwriting, painfully familiar to her.

She hadn't expected him to already be considering names for Mu Wenxuan's child...

The poor soul once in her womb had never been afforded such consideration, to the point where he couldn't even bear to touch her belly on the rare occasions they met.
